Transaction 1931361337c4e99053ade081131c2cae44a7cfa51d7ee297f81e2301a0b49ea0
1 Input
1 Output
-
1931361337c4e99053ade081131c2cae44a7cfa51d7ee297f81e2301a0b49ea0:0
- value
- 24392054
- script pubkey
- OP_0 OP_PUSHBYTES_20 43bb7df33410dd309472af5f552eef9101f4e66a
- address
- ltc1qgwahmue5zrwnp9rj4a042th0jyqlfen26ju9te